Tradescantia Pallida Three Master Flower Commelina Growth - High resolution null wallpaper (3051x4576)

Tradescantia Pallida Three Master Flower Commelina Growth

Download Options

Details

Resolution3051×4576
CategoryN/A
Sourcepixabay
Likes2
Downloads197

Author

carlosfx
View Profile